Cliff Wilson
Clifford Wilson is a partner in this firm and has been in practice since 1983. Mr. Wilson received a B.S. Degree in Nutrition from the University of Connecticut in 1978. He also received a J.D. Degree from Memphis State University in 1983. Upon graduation Mr. Wilson has a one year appointment to the law clerk for William H.D. Fones, Chief Justice of The Tennessee Supreme Court. Mr. Wilson has a litigation practice involving workers' compensation defense, insurance defense, and nursing home litigation.
Mr. Wilson has presented a number of continuing education programs concerning workers' compensation and premises liability. He has chaired the Nashville Bar Association Fee Dispute Committee. Mr. Wilson has been recently appointed by the Tennessee Supreme Court for a three year term to be a hearing committee member for the Board of Professional Responsibility. This term expires in 2009.
